Workshop Labourer(Montrose)

4 months ago


Montrose, United Kingdom NOV Inc. Full time

CLOSING DATE 1 FEBRUARY 2023

**D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ES**:

- Maintain housekeeping to high standard in manufacturing workshops and outside storage areas
- Operate overhead gantry cranes
- Power wash equipment - Assist painter / blaster as required
- Maintain housekeeping and coverall storage with locker room
- Carry out on time deliveries and pick-ups
- Maintain high levels of cleanliness and order within facility and within a safe state at all times
- Operate forklift and side loader as and when required
- Empty swarf, material off-cuts and waste containers when required
- Work collaboratively with and assist all departments as and when required, including machine operators and management
- Make sure workflow is maximised by moving components to the correct stations
- Accurately complete all details on time sheets/Kronos electronic timekeeping - return them to the Fabrication Lead on completion of a shift
- Demonstrate awareness of company objectives, policies and procedures
- Identify and communicate health and safety risks making recommendations to Supervisor to improve workshop operations
- Ensure all company policies surrounding, health & safety, quality requirements and housekeeping are met
- Maintain production area housekeeping 5S
- Conduct all material movements in accordance with the company’s safe working practices
- Minimise waste by using/disposing of raw materials and consumable items efficiently
- Be fully familiar and conversant with department and company policies, procedures and processes, ensuring all work and actions undertaken are in full compliance at all times
- Support other departments and carry out other duties as and when business requirements dictate as may be reasonably expected by line manager
